Help File Organization

This help file is organized into five main topics:
  • Introduction: Which you are reading now.
  • Imaging Strategies: This section discusses strategies for key functions and activities surrounding image acquisition.  Using the tools provided in CCDAutoPilot, along with some scientifically-based recommendations, you will be able to achieve optimum results.
  • Command Summary: This section describes all the commands available for the menu bar and the commands and settings on the individual pages that are accessed by the buttons down the left side of the main window.  Hitting the F1 key will bring up the help topic for the specific page you are viewing.
  • Other Applications: This section discusses additional included applications to assist in troubleshooting and configuring your system.
  • Troubleshooting: Given the number of possible interactions among CCDAutoPilot, the applications it controls and the hardware these applications subsequently control, it is possible during the learning curve to run into unexpected actions and consequences.  This section will help you through those unintended consequences.
